ABSTRACT:
Examines the effects of participation in intercollegiate sports on subsequent occupational attainment. Athletic categories consisted of star, major sport star, team sport, and spatially central playing position. Dependent variables were occupational prestige and earnings. Results refuted the notion that athletics act as a stepping stone to success.
